On June 1, a student at Nanchang University, China, posted a photo showing “a body with teeth, eyes, and a nose,” which the student received in his rice bowl at the university’s canteen.

Now it seems to have happened again.

After first discovering a rat’s head, food inspectors claimed it was a duck’s neck that the student had eaten.

– How did the duck’s neck grow? asks one of the several thousand people who interacted with the student’s video, according to South China Morning Post.

Subsequent investigations categorically rejected this claim and confirmed that it was a rat’s head, according to what he said China Daily.

The newspaper now also writes that the market regulation agency in Xiushan County has realized that a fresh rat head was found in the lunch of an unlucky canteen guest.

The newspaper said that the discovery was made this time in the canteen of a traditional Chinese medicine hospital.

China Daily writes that the hospital, which has its canteen food provided by an outside state-owned supplier, has never had similar results before.

It is not revealed if it is the same supplier that delivers food to the university.
